Protests Erupt Outside Siddaramaiah’s Residence Demanding Ministerial Position for Raghavendra Hitnal

Supporters of MLA Raghavendra Hitnal protested outside former Karnataka Chief Minister Siddaramaiah’s residence in Bengaluru, demanding Hitnal's appointment as a minister and additional representation for the Kuruba community from North Karnataka.

In Bengaluru, supporters of MLA Raghavendra Hitnal protested outside the residence of former Chief Minister Siddaramaiah, demanding that Hitnal be appointed as a minister. The protesters also sought increased representation for the Kuruba community from North Karnataka, requesting an additional ministerial position. Urban Development Minister Dr. Yathindra, who is Siddaramaiah’s son, addressed the demonstrators, urging them to remain calm and stating that their demands were valid. He promised to relay their requests to his father and assured that discussions would take place with the party's high command to address their concerns.

The protest highlights community demands for political representation in Karnataka's government.
